Based on the original pavement, this technology gradually forms a membrane layer with both rigidity and flexibility by spraying flexible membrane agent, addressing the issues of dust raising on sunny days and muddy conditions on rainy days, reducing water spraying by 70% or more.


Based on the native pavement, by continuously spraying the MiningRoad flexible membrane agent, the material gradually penetrates into the native pavement, forming a stable layer, and the surface forms a layer of membrane layer that has “flexibility and toughness”.


This membrane agent undergoes a series of physicochemical reactions with the native soil, including changes to soil particle charge, bridge-link, hydration, compaction, and adsorption, initially forming a membrane layer with a thickness of 2-4mm. With continuous spraying, it possesses a strong dust suppression function, gradually thickening to 4-5mm, and in some areas reaching 6-8mm thick.

Features of Flexible Pavement Film-Forming Technology

On the basis of the original road surface, the flexible film-forming agent is gradually infiltrated into the original road surface through the "wet film-forming" construction process. The flexible film-forming agent reacts with the soil and stone particles or waste residues of the original road surface and gradually forms a flexible film-forming layer that is both flexible, tough and waterproof.

  • The flexible film-forming agent has certain biological activity characteristics: it can "press", "grow", and "resist pressure". As the vehicles continue to roll over, the sand and gravel aggregates and dust are pressed into the layer and become part of the layer, and the thickness gradually reaches more than 10mm. The increase in aggregates can resist the heavy pressure and friction of heavy-loaded vehicles.

  • The flexible film-forming agent also has the function of "slow release of dust suppressants". It contains bio-based dust suppressants and has a slow release function, which prolongs the use effect of dust suppressants.
